Transaction 43779950018e833be29521f4d16da7d7f63d26a1ec9730b3f32ef0936bb27473
1 Input
1 Output
-
43779950018e833be29521f4d16da7d7f63d26a1ec9730b3f32ef0936bb27473:0
- value
- 24281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ba28ac01ec51a13fa7013bddb3b26f322956c329 OP_EQUAL
- address
- 3JfLLA6eWX1PrQD8khLSgA9NtNJDnh52RG